For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 446 students in Hillsborough City Elementary School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 1% of public middle schools in California.
Public Middle School in Hillsborough City Elementary School District have an average math proficiency score of 83% (versus the California public middle school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 82% (versus the 46% statewide average).
The top-ranked public middle school in Hillsborough City Elementary School District is Crocker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king. Minority enrollment is 61% of the student body (majority Asian), which is less than the California public middle school average of 78%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$29,004 is higher than the state median of $20,100. The school district revenue/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$28,428 is higher than the state median of $18,512.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
